Physics
H = -t Σ c†ᵢσcⱼσ + U Σ nᵢ↑nᵢ↓ - μ Σ nᵢ
Mott gap: Δ ≈ U - W (W=bandwidth)
U_c ≈ W ≈ 2zt (z=coordination)
Half-filling: metal if U < U_c(T)
